Transaction 42ab6390ef8c3bca9ab46624460b3717ecead4a0aa0f2f76c58b8d7dac19978c
1 Input
1 Outputs
- 42ab6390ef8c3bca9ab46624460b3717ecead4a0aa0f2f76c58b8d7dac19978c:0
value 425392
address 14oerzp7gnRdNtPLWQnz5frDYNuXZKBN4C